It is the process through which individuals acquire knowledge, skills, values, and attitudes that enable them to understand the world and actively participate in it. From early childhood learning to higher education and lifelong training, education influences personal growth, economic progress, and social stability. A strong education system is essential for creating informed citizens and building a sustainable future.

At the individual level, education empowers people by expanding their opportunities and potential. Basic education provides essential skills such as literacy and numeracy, which are necessary for communication, employment, and everyday decision-making. As individuals progress through secondary and higher education, they gain specialized knowledge and critical thinking skills that prepare them for professional careers and leadership roles. Education nurtures confidence, creativity, and independence, enabling learners to pursue their goals and aspirations.

Education also plays a vital role in economic development. A well-educated population contributes to a skilled workforce that drives productivity, innovation, and competitiveness. Employers increasingly seek individuals who can think critically, solve problems, and adapt to change—qualities developed through effective education. Countries that invest in education tend to experience stronger economic growth, reduced unemployment, and improved living standards. By equipping individuals with market-relevant skills, education helps break the cycle of poverty and promotes social mobility.

Beyond economic benefits, education is crucial for social and cultural development. Schools and universities are not only centers of academic learning but also spaces where social values are shaped. Education promotes respect for diversity, equality, and human rights. It encourages individuals to understand different perspectives, engage in constructive dialogue, and contribute positively to their communities. Through civic education, learners become aware of their rights and responsibilities, strengthening democratic participation and social cohesion.

In the modern era, education is undergoing rapid transformation due to technological advancements. Digital tools, online learning platforms, and virtual classrooms have reshaped how knowledge is delivered and accessed. Technology has made education more flexible and accessible, especially for learners in remote or underserved areas. Students can now access global resources, collaborate across borders, and develop digital literacy skills essential for the 21st century. However, ensuring equal access to technology remains a critical challenge that must be addressed to avoid widening educational inequalities.

Teachers and educators are central to the success of any education system. Their expertise, dedication, and ability to inspire learners significantly influence educational outcomes. Effective educators create supportive learning environments, adapt teaching methods to diverse needs, and encourage curiosity and lifelong learning. Continuous professional development for teachers is essential to keep pace with changing curricula, technologies, and student needs. Recognizing and supporting educators is key to maintaining high-quality education.

Education is not limited to formal schooling; it is a lifelong process. Lifelong learning enables individuals to continuously update their skills, adapt to changing job markets, and respond to new social and technological developments. Vocational training, professional courses, and informal learning opportunities help individuals remain relevant and engaged throughout their lives. Lifelong education also promotes personal fulfillment and active aging.

Despite its importance, education systems worldwide face challenges such as unequal access, limited resources, outdated curricula, and quality disparities. Addressing these challenges requires collaboration between governments, educational institutions, communities, and the private sector. Investment in infrastructure, teacher training, inclusive policies, and innovative learning approaches is essential to ensure that education meets the needs of all learners.

In conclusion, education is a powerful force that shapes individuals and societies. It fosters knowledge, skills, and values that drive economic growth, social harmony, and sustainable development. By prioritizing quality and inclusive education, societies can unlock human potential and create a brighter, more equitable future for generations to come.
